Bought this jack plate from L&M in Lethbridge. Should have come standard on my 2018 Gibson Les Paul Studio ($2000 guitar). Instead it had a black plastic one. So when I tightened it up when it came loose it cracked into a dozen pieces. This one I cranked the nut tight and loctited it. Not coming off again. Looks nicer too.
Of course when I picked it up I saw one just like mine but 2019 with the metal plate. So clearly Gibson knew it was a flaw. I probably could have got one for free from Gibson if I complained, but for a few bucks I bought it and shut my mouth.
Also it comes with 2 screws for 4 holes. Lucky for me the stock screws were chrome and matched.
